Text abbreviations started to become popular with the upsurge of texting as one of the most useful communication channels. By the time they were developing, SMS had already proved to be a fast and convenient communication channel.
Thus, abbreviations were only complementing the advantages of text messages. As much as SMS is one of the best communication channels, it has always had one major drawback. Each text message is limited to only characters at most, which, if exceeded, counts as two messages and is charged additionally. Text abbreviations solve this problem by cutting down some characters and giving room for more words.
The tendency of using shorter form of words, phrases or sentences was carried away from text messages to social media communication apps. Although those apps are free to use and have no character limit, text abbreviations still remain popular with them. They save time and make typing on small and inconvenient sensor keyboards more comfortable. Aside from helping individuals, text abbreviations also help businesses in their SMS marketing campaigns. Every SMS costs money for businesses too, therefore, they can use abbreviations to save some money.

Our online offer includes YouTube videos, for whose playback we use a plug-in of the YouTube service operated by Google hereinafter referred to as "YouTube". The operator of the service is Google.
We use the YouTube service in advanced privacy mode to protect your privacy as much as possible. If you visit a website of our online offer on which a YouTube video is integrated, Google initially only receives the information necessary for integration and no cookies are set for usage analysis. Only when you play the embedded video does Google receive further information; Google may also set cookies to analyze your user behavior. When playing the video, Google's YouTube servers are informed, for example, about which page of our online offer you are playing the video from.
If you are logged in to your Google Account, you enable Google or YouTube to assign your surfing behavior directly to your personal Google profile. We therefore recommend that you only play embedded YouTube videos if you agree to the associated data processing by Google. You can prevent the assignment of data to your Google profile by logging out of your YouTube account.
